Can energy storage reduce curtailment?

A key element of using energy storage to integrate renewable energy and reduce curtailment is identifying the timescales of storage needed—that is, the duration of energy storage capacity per unit of power capacity.

Can energy storage devices avoid curtailment?

The ability to avoid curtailment is a function of both the power and energy capacities of the energy storage device. We perform simulations with varying energy storage sizes to examine curtailment reduction with a focus on the role of duration.

Why is curtailment necessary in a solar system?

In a solar system, curtailment is necessary to avoid high penetrations or back-feeding, where more energy is produced than consumed. High penetrations of solar generation can lead to voltage control issues due to the variability of the resource.

Why do wind turbines need energy storage?

Wind turbines often generate more electricity than is immediately consumed. By storing and later releasing this excess energy, energy storage systems effectively address the challenge of mismatches between wind power generation and electricity demand.

How do you store wind power?

There are several ways to store wind power, including battery storage, pumped hydro storage, compressed air energy storage, flywheel storage, and hydrogen storage. Each method has its advantages and disadvantages, but they all provide a way to store wind power and help to ensure that a constant supply of power is available for the grid.

How does a residential energy storage system work?

Residential Energy Storage Systems work by storing electricity in a battery when it is generated or when the demand for electricity is low. For instance, if you have solar panels installed, your ESS will store excess power generated by the panels during sunny days.
